A Life of Purpose and Unbroken Dedication to Service

Born on July 8, 1959, Senator Okowa rose through the ranks of public service with a sterling reputation for performance, integrity, and prudence. A medical doctor by training and a leader by calling, he served in various capacities including Local Government Chairman ,Commissioner, Secretary to the State Government, Senator, and eventually as Governor of Delta State from 2015 to 2023.

During his eight-year tenure, Okowa introduced numerous people-centered policies and sustainable infrastructural projects under the widely celebrated SMART Agenda and Stronger Delta Vision, with remarkable achievements in health care (including the establishment of the Asaba Specialist Hospital), youth empowerment, road infrastructure, education, peace-building, and job creation through institutions like the Delta State Job and Wealth Creation Bureau.
